Output 58af1e6b2344d994067104a1bf23bbdd283243c6e2b257d591c253357f899305:158

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 833dabde1525c664cf529abc85612703dc543fba4b7e8f2a2f981dfe22c811d7
address
bc1psv76hhs4yhrxfn6jn27g2cf8q0w9g0a6fdlg7230nqwlugkgz8ts66g2dv
transaction
58af1e6b2344d994067104a1bf23bbdd283243c6e2b257d591c253357f899305
spent
false